Super Time privacy policy
Last updated: 17 August 2026
Overview
Super Time does not require an account. Metronome settings, practice recordings, practice history, presets, and saved setups are stored on your device.
Practice Circles
If you join an invited Practice Circle, the display name you choose, a random participant identifier, timing and presence messages, and chat messages you send are processed temporarily to operate that live session. The Circle does not transmit microphone audio, recordings, practice history, or saved presets.
On-device improvement signals
The current iOS build keeps bounded product-use signals on the device. No telemetry endpoint is configured for that build, so those signals are not transmitted to our servers. They do not include audio, recordings, notes, feedback text, email addresses, or exact practice settings.
Microphone and purchases
Microphone audio is processed on the device for recording and tuner features. Apple processes optional Pro purchases; we do not receive your payment card details.
